The autopilot works as it is supposed to work in a Boeing 717.

AUTO FLIGHT - activates the autothrottle on the ground when it over 40%, and turns on/off the autopilot in flight.

- Right-clicking the corresponding knobs will set and hold the current SPD, HDG or ALT value.
The pilot can also select SPD, HDG or ALT by “dragging” the knob with the left mouse button or scrolling the mouse wheel.
The pilot can then press the middle mouse button to activate the mode and the autopilot will follow the selected value.

- the FMS SPD button activates the FMS speed hold mode.
- the NAV button activates FMS lateral control.
- the PROF button activates the vertical mode (maintaining the vertical FMS profile).
- the APPR/LAND button activates approach mode.
